
Excel公式计算出现RC的解决方法:更改引用样式、识别和修正错误、使用正确的公式语法。其中,更改引用样式是最常见的解决方法。Excel中出现RC(Row-Column)引用样式通常是因为默认的A1引用样式被修改为R1C1引用样式。R1C1引用样式是Excel中的一种特殊引用模式,用于表示单元格的位置,与我们常用的A1引用样式不同。可以通过Excel选项中的设置来切换回A1引用样式,解决这个问题。
一、更改引用样式
1、R1C1引用样式的概述
R1C1引用样式是一种行列引用模式,R表示行(Row),C表示列(Column)。这种引用方式通常用于复杂的公式计算和编程。不同于A1引用样式,它更加直接和简洁,但对于不熟悉的人来说,可能会觉得难以理解。例如,R1C1表示第一行第一列的单元格,而R2C2则表示第二行第二列的单元格。
2、切换引用样式的方法
要解决Excel公式计算中出现RC的问题,最直接的办法就是切换回A1引用样式。具体步骤如下:
- 打开Excel应用程序。
- 点击左上角的“文件”菜单,选择“选项”。
- 在弹出的“Excel选项”窗口中,选择“公式”选项卡。
- 在“工作表公式”部分,取消“R1C1引用样式”的勾选。
- 点击“确定”保存更改。
通过上述步骤,Excel将恢复为A1引用样式,公式中的RC引用将自动转换为常见的A1引用方式。
3、示例
假设在R1C1引用样式下,公式为:=R2C2+R3C3。在A1引用样式下,这个公式将变为=B2+C3。通过切换引用样式,用户可以更直观地理解和编辑公式。
二、识别和修正错误
1、常见错误类型
在使用Excel进行计算时,除了引用样式的错误外,还可能遇到其他类型的错误。例如,公式中的引用错误、数据类型错误、函数使用错误等。这些错误都会影响计算结果,甚至导致公式无法正常工作。
2、如何识别错误
Excel提供了一些工具和功能来帮助用户识别和修正错误:
- 错误检查:在“公式”选项卡中,点击“错误检查”按钮,Excel会自动检查当前工作表中的错误。
- 错误提示:当公式中出现错误时,Excel会在单元格中显示错误提示,例如
#REF!、#DIV/0!等。 - 审查公式:使用“审查”功能,可以逐步查看公式的计算过程,找出错误的来源。
3、修正错误的方法
修正错误的方法主要包括:
- 检查公式:仔细检查公式中的每一个部分,确保引用正确、函数使用正确、数据类型匹配。
- 使用错误处理函数:Excel提供了一些错误处理函数,例如
IFERROR、ISERROR等,可以帮助捕获和处理错误。 - 调试公式:使用Excel的调试工具,逐步查看公式的计算过程,找出错误的来源并进行修正。
三、使用正确的公式语法
1、了解公式语法
Excel公式语法是指公式的书写规则和结构。正确的公式语法是确保公式正常工作的前提。一个正确的公式通常包括以下几个部分:等号(=)、函数名、参数和运算符。
2、常见公式语法错误
常见的公式语法错误包括:
- 缺少等号:所有公式必须以等号开头,如果缺少等号,Excel将把公式当作文本处理。
- 函数名拼写错误:函数名必须拼写正确,任何拼写错误都会导致公式无法识别。
- 参数错误:函数的参数必须符合要求,包括数量、类型和格式。
- 运算符错误:运算符必须正确使用,包括加减乘除、括号等。
3、如何避免和修正语法错误
避免和修正语法错误的方法包括:
- 熟悉公式语法:学习和掌握常用公式的语法规则,确保书写正确。
- 使用函数向导:Excel提供了函数向导,可以帮助用户正确输入函数和参数。
- 检查公式:在输入公式后,仔细检查每一个部分,确保没有语法错误。
- 使用错误提示:当出现语法错误时,Excel会提供错误提示,根据提示进行修正。
四、深入理解R1C1引用样式
1、R1C1引用样式的优点
虽然R1C1引用样式不如A1引用样式直观,但它在某些情况下具有独特的优势:
- 更直接的引用:R1C1引用样式直接使用行列号,避免了A1引用样式中的字母和数字混合,适合编程和自动化任务。
- 减少错误:对于某些复杂的公式计算,R1C1引用样式可以减少引用错误,提高准确性。
- 便于批量操作:在编写宏和脚本时,R1C1引用样式更便于编程和批量操作。
2、如何使用R1C1引用样式
要使用R1C1引用样式,可以通过以下步骤进行设置:
- 打开Excel应用程序。
- 点击左上角的“文件”菜单,选择“选项”。
- 在弹出的“Excel选项”窗口中,选择“公式”选项卡。
- 在“工作表公式”部分,勾选“R1C1引用样式”。
- 点击“确定”保存更改。
设置完成后,Excel将使用R1C1引用样式,用户可以按照这种引用方式编写公式。
3、示例
假设在R1C1引用样式下,公式为:=R[-1]C+R[-2]C2。这个公式表示当前单元格的上一个单元格加上当前单元格上两个单元格的第二列单元格。在A1引用样式下,这个公式将变为=A1+B2。
五、公式计算中的其他常见问题
1、数据类型错误
在Excel公式计算中,数据类型错误是常见问题之一。不同的数据类型(如文本、数值、日期等)在公式计算中的处理方式不同,混合使用可能导致错误。
如何识别和修正数据类型错误
- 识别数据类型:通过单元格格式设置,查看和识别单元格中的数据类型。
- 转换数据类型:使用Excel的转换功能,将数据转换为正确的类型。例如,使用
VALUE函数将文本转换为数值,使用TEXT函数将数值转换为文本。 - 一致性检查:确保公式中使用的数据类型一致,避免混合使用不同的数据类型。
2、引用范围错误
引用范围错误是指公式中引用的单元格范围不正确,导致公式无法正常计算。
如何避免和修正引用范围错误
- 检查引用范围:仔细检查公式中的引用范围,确保引用的单元格范围正确。
- 使用命名范围:使用命名范围可以提高引用的准确性和可读性。通过定义命名范围,可以避免手动输入引用范围时的错误。
- 动态引用范围:使用动态引用范围(如
OFFSET函数)可以自动调整引用范围,避免因数据变化导致的引用错误。
3、循环引用错误
循环引用错误是指公式中引用了自身或导致无限循环的引用,导致公式无法计算。
如何识别和修正循环引用错误
- 识别循环引用:Excel会自动检测循环引用,并在状态栏中显示提示。可以通过“公式”选项卡中的“循环引用”功能查看具体的循环引用位置。
- 修正循环引用:找到循环引用的来源,修改公式或引用,避免循环引用的发生。
- 使用迭代计算:在某些情况下,可以使用迭代计算来处理循环引用。在“Excel选项”中,启用迭代计算,并设置最大迭代次数和最大误差。
六、提高公式计算效率的技巧
1、使用数组公式
数组公式是指可以同时处理多个值的公式,提高计算效率和准确性。
如何使用数组公式
- 输入数组公式:在输入数组公式时,使用
Ctrl+Shift+Enter组合键,Excel会自动将公式括在花括号中。 - 应用场景:数组公式适用于需要同时处理多个值的计算,例如求和、求平均值、查找等。
2、优化公式结构
优化公式结构可以提高计算效率,减少计算时间。
如何优化公式结构
- 简化公式:尽量简化公式结构,避免冗长和复杂的公式。
- 减少重复计算:通过定义中间变量或使用命名范围,减少重复计算,提高计算效率。
- 合理使用函数:选择适当的函数,提高公式的执行效率。例如,使用
SUM函数代替多个相加运算。
3、使用快捷键和技巧
使用快捷键和技巧可以提高工作效率,减少手动操作的时间。
常用快捷键和技巧
- 复制和粘贴公式:使用
Ctrl+C和Ctrl+V快捷键快速复制和粘贴公式。 - 自动填充:使用自动填充功能,可以快速填充公式,提高工作效率。
- 函数向导:使用函数向导可以快速输入函数和参数,避免手动输入错误。
七、总结
Excel公式计算出现RC的问题主要是由于引用样式设置为R1C1引用样式所致。通过更改引用样式、识别和修正错误、使用正确的公式语法等方法,可以有效解决这个问题。此外,深入理解R1C1引用样式、避免常见问题、提高公式计算效率等技巧,可以帮助用户更好地使用Excel进行数据处理和分析。通过不断学习和实践,用户可以提高Excel公式计算的准确性和效率,提升工作效率和数据分析能力。
相关问答FAQs:
1. 什么是Excel中的RC引用?
RC引用是Excel中一种特殊的单元格引用方式,它使用R和C代表行和列的相对位置。通过使用RC引用,可以轻松地在公式中进行单元格的相对偏移计算,而不必手动输入具体的行列坐标。
2. 如何在Excel中使用RC引用进行公式计算?
要使用RC引用进行公式计算,只需在公式中使用R和C来表示行和列的相对偏移。例如,如果你想将某个单元格的值与其下方单元格的值相加,可以使用"=RC+1"的公式,其中RC代表当前单元格的行和列。
3. 如何使用RC引用进行区域计算?
使用RC引用进行区域计算同样非常简单。如果你想对某个区域内的单元格求和,可以使用"=SUM(RC:RC[3])"的公式,其中RC代表当前单元格的位置,RC[3]代表当前单元格向右偏移3列的位置。这将会将当前单元格及其右侧3列的单元格相加求和。
4. 如何在Excel中调整RC引用的相对位置?
如果需要调整RC引用的相对位置,只需在公式中修改R和C的值即可。例如,如果你想将RC引用向下偏移一行,可以将"=RC"修改为"=R[1]C";如果你想将RC引用向右偏移两列,可以将"=RC"修改为"=RC[2]"。这样就可以根据需要灵活地调整RC引用的相对位置。
5. RC引用与常规单元格引用有什么不同?
与常规的A1引用相比,RC引用更加直观和灵活,特别适用于需要进行相对偏移计算的情况。而A1引用则需要手动输入具体的行列坐标,相对偏移计算比较繁琐。因此,对于需要频繁进行相对偏移计算的用户来说,使用RC引用可以提高效率和准确性。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4567761